### Audit Item 14 — Spreadsheet Export Memory

Check: GridPress export service must stream rows instead of buffering full workbooks in memory. Verify peak RSS stays under 1 GB on the 500k-row test fixture. Last quarter's audit found exports holding entire sheets in heap, causing pod restarts. Confirm the streaming flag is enabled in all three regions and attach profiler output. Findings go to the service owner, named below.

named custodian: Brivan Eliath Quenox Frador

Canteen note: the third-floor canteen at Wexhall Point is shared with Dunmore Analytics next door. Their staff enter via the link bridge at lunch only, 12:00–14:00. Do not sign them into our visitor log; the bridge door handles it. Reception can open the bridge door when needed using the code below.

badge for badup-kahif: bdg-LHI-9

## Changelog — Font vendoring defaults changed

As of this release, the Bracken UI build no longer fetches third-party fonts at build time. All typefaces used by the Lanternwell suite are now vendored into the repo under a dedicated assets directory, and the fetch step is skipped by default. If you're onboarding, nothing to install — the fonts travel with the checkout. The build flags controlling this behavior are listed below.

settings of hadup-yafog:
LAMAEL_PIN=3761
LAMAEL_TENANT=istmir
LAMAEL_METRICS_HOST=metrics.lamael.plorvasys.test
LAMAEL_SEAL=seal_8ea68500
LAMAEL_STANDBY_TEAM=fraok